Bertold Hummel composed this two-movement work for 12 strings (7 violins, 2 violas, 2 cellos and 1 double bass) in December 1980 and at the beginning of 1981. The first movement (quarter = 60) builds up cluster chords from the piano, effects such as glissandi, trills and tremolos bring the colours of the instruments to bloom, which fade out again in pianissimo at the end. The 2nd movement (ostinato) fascinates with its rapid motorisation, which is only brought to a halt at the end of the short work with a striking Bartok pizzicato. Klangfarben was premiered with the "Deutsches Solistenensemble" under the direction of the composer at the European Centre for Scientific, Ecumenical and Cultural Cooperation in Askri (Greece) on 13 September 1981.
